Furnished Condos vs. Empty Condos: What Is the Difference?
An unfurnished condo gives you a blank space—but it also gives you a lengthy to-do list. You will need to source furniture, arrange delivery, buy dishes and linens, set up Wi-Fi, and decide what to do with everything when your stay ends. That may work for a permanent move when you already own a full household of furniture. It is rarely the simplest option for a temporary assignment, a relocation period, or someone arriving with only personal belongings.

Five Features to Look for in a Grande Prairie Condo Rental
1. A Comfortable, Furnished Living Space
Look beyond photos of the bedroom. A quality furnished condo should have a sensible layout, comfortable seating, a sleeping area with a proper bed, and enough room to relax after work. The goal is a functional home, not a temporary box.
2. Kitchen Access
For short or long stays, kitchen access creates flexibility. A kitchenette or full kitchen lets you prepare daily meals, pack lunches, and keep your routine on track. It is one of the most useful features for renters who are tired of restaurant meals and hotel microwaves.
3. Laundry and Parking
In-suite or on-site laundry and dependable parking may sound ordinary, but they make a substantial difference to a tenant’s routine. If you are driving to work, ask about plug-in parking and the parking setup. If you are working shifts, ask how and when laundry facilities are available.
4. Transparent Monthly Costs
Make sure you know what your monthly rate covers. A furnished condo with included utilities and Wi-Fi can be easier to budget for than a lower base rent that requires several separate accounts and variable monthly bills. Clear pricing lets you make a fair comparison between options.
